Phuntsholing is a vibrant town located in southern Bhutan, right at the border with India. It serves as a key entry point for travelers coming into Bhutan. The town is known for its lively atmosphere, blending Bhutanese culture with influences from neighboring India. Phuntsholing is a bustling commercial hub, where you can find shops, markets, and restaurants. The town is set against the backdrop of beautiful mountains and lush green landscapes, making it an attractive place for tourists.
Phuntsholing is easily accessible from India. The nearest airport is Bagdogra Airport (IXB) in West Bengal, which is about 160 kilometers away. From Bagdogra, you can hire a taxi or take a bus to reach Phuntsholing. The journey takes approximately four to five hours.
Once you arrive in Phuntsholing, getting around is quite easy. The town has a good network of roads. Taxis and auto-rickshaws are readily available for local transport. You can also rent bicycles or scooters for a more adventurous experience. Phuntsholing is small enough to explore on foot, making it easy to visit nearby attractions.

Phuntsholing offers a variety of dining options, from local Bhutanese cuisine to international fare. Here are some popular food choices:
Try local dishes like Ema Datshi, a spicy cheese and chili dish considered the national favorite. Another popular option is Phaksha Paa, which is pork cooked with radishes and chilies. You can also enjoy Jasha Maroo, a spicy chicken dish that pairs well with rice.
Phuntsholing’s market has plenty of street food stalls. You can find tasty snacks like momos (dumplings) and thukpa (noodle soup). These are perfect for a quick bite while exploring the town.
There are several restaurants in Phuntsholing offering Indian, Chinese, and continental dishes. You can enjoy flavorful curries, biryanis, and various vegetarian options. Many restaurants have outdoor seating, allowing you to enjoy your meal with a view.
Cafes are a great place to relax and enjoy a cup of Bhutanese butter tea or coffee. They often serve snacks and desserts, making them perfect for a break after a day of exploring.
